NOTE: Product meets ANSI Z21.1 requirements for 0"
clearance to back and side walls below the cooktop.
TO
Wall coverings, counters and cabinets around range must
withstand heat (up to 194°F) generated by the range.

STANDARD INSTALLATION
If the construction of your cabinet cannot provide a 1/4" flat area at the back of the countertop opening,
consider changing the countertop to accommodate this dimension. See Alternate Construction section.
